Thank you for your comments. I now feel I should change my interpretation.
The error, "the query part must not be used", should be reported in the
query part. Likewise, the fallback corresponding to
"response_mode=query.jwt" should be "response_mode=query".

I did some experiments with a certain giant IdP to see how their
OpenID-certified implementation reports an error. The observed result is
that the IdP supports response_mode=form_post but ignores
response_mode=query. Their discovery JSON does not include
response_modes_supported. For every error case I tried except
"error=access_denied", the IdP returned "400 Bad Request + HTML" whenever
it detected an error condition (e.g. "Nonce required for response_type
id_token") even if valid redirect_uri, client_id, response_type and scope
were given. "error=access_denied" was reported in the fragment part even if
the authorization request included response_mode=query.

>>>> Hello,
>>>>
>>>> 4.3.1. Response Mode "query.jwt"
>>>> <https://openid.net/specs/openid-financial-api-jarm.html#response-mode-query.jwt>
>>>> says as follows:
>>>>
>>>> *Note: "query.jwt" MUST NOT be used in conjunction with response types
>>>> that contain "token" or "id_token" unless the response JWT is encrypted to
>>>> prevent token leakage in the URL.*
>>>>
>>>>
>>>> This implies that, if the JWT is encrypted, "query.jwt" can be used
>>>> even if the default response mode of the response type is "fragment". This
>>>> can happen, for example, when an authorization request includes
>>>> "response_type=id_token&response_mode=query.jwt" and the
>>>> "authorization_encrypted_response_alg" metadata of the client is set.
>>>>
>>>> If an error occurred during building the JWT in the case above, how
>>>> should the error be reported? Should the response parameters ("error",
>>>> "error_description", "error_uri", "state") be embedded in the query part or
>>>> in the fragment part?
>>>>
>>>> IMHO, in this case, "fragment" should be chosen as the fallback
>>>> response mode. The following is a pseudocode.
>>>>
>>>> // Special case. If the response mode is "query.jwt" although the
>>>> // default response mode of the response type is "fragment", it
>>>> // means that "query.jwt" was allowed on the assumption that the
>>>> // JWT would be encrypted. This happens when the response_mode
>>>> // request parameter of the authorization request is "query.jwt"
>>>> // and the 'authorization_encrypted_response_alg' metadata of the
>>>> // client is set.
>>>> //
>>>> // Because an authorization response JWT failed to be created and
>>>> // so the response parameters won't be encrypted, the query part
>>>> // should not be used. Therefore, in this case, "query.jwt" is
>>>> // converted not to "query" but to "fragment".
>>>> if (mResponseMode == ResponseMode.QUERY_JWT &&
>>>>     mResponseType.requiresImplicitFlow())
>>>> {
>>>>     // Change "query.jwt" to "fragment".
>>>>     mResponseMode = ResponseMode.FRAGMENT;
>>>> }
>>>> else
>>>> {
>>>>     // Change "{???}.jwt" to "{???}".
>>>>     mResponseMode = mResponseMode.withoutJwt();
>>>> }
>>>>
>>>>
>>>> This is implementable (and actually I have implemented the logic), but
>>>> I'm not sure all implementers will reach the same conclusion and I'm afraid
>>>> this will harm interoperability.
>>>>
>>>> This complexity is introduced by the condition, *"unless the response
>>>> JWT is encrypted"*. I think there are two options.
>>>>
>>>>
>>>>    1. Remove the condition and state that "query.jwt" should not be
>>>>    used when the default response mode of the response type is not "query"
>>>>    even if the JWT is encrypted.
>>>>    2. Keep the condition and describe in detail how the error case
>>>>    should be handled.
>>>>
>>>>
>>>> Do you have any thought?
